Transaction 124a69293e59643169d31eba444a2e93662e23aa19d3602fc6a35d0dcb79784e

5 Input
2 Outputs
  • 124a69293e59643169d31eba444a2e93662e23aa19d3602fc6a35d0dcb79784e:0
  • value  88154
    address  bc1qw0gdv2tvd960pte7acsttuqjn485lgmcqwrgvm
  • 124a69293e59643169d31eba444a2e93662e23aa19d3602fc6a35d0dcb79784e:1
  • value  32085870
    address  1Lw35fzc4KPm2rbL31hKhWfd83R2GstPkz